Spicy Stir-Fried Bulgogi

If you’ve been relying on delivery food or instant meals all weekend, here’s a special recipe to refresh your palate with a delightful kick of spice! Transform your leftover beef bulgogi into a rich, flavorful, and perfectly spicy stir-fry that tastes like it came from a professional kitchen, all made conveniently at home.

Recipe Info

  • Category : Main dish
  • Ingredient Category : Beef
  • Occasion : Everyday
  • Cooking : Boil / Simmer
  • Servings : 2 servings
  • Cooking Time : Within 30 minutes
  • Difficulty : Anyone

Main Ingredients

  • Leftover Beef Bulgogi (approx. 1 serving)
  • 1/2 Carrot
  • Mushrooms of your choice (e.g., shiitake, oyster mushrooms)
  • 2 Korean Green Chilies (Cheongyang peppers)
  • 1.5 cups Water (approx. 300ml)
  • 1/2 stalk Green Onion

Seasoning Sauce

  • 0.5 Tbsp Gochujang (Korean chili paste)
  • 1.5 Tbsp Sugar
  • 4 Tbsp Gochugaru (Korean chili flakes, fine)
  • 2 Tbsp Gukganjang (Korean soup soy sauce)
  • 1.5 Tbsp Maesil Extract (Plum extract)
  • 2 Tbsp Minced Garlic

Cooking Instructions

Step 1

First, let’s prepare the delicious sauce that will define the flavor of this dish. In a bowl, combine 0.5 Tbsp of gochujang, 1.5 Tbsp of sugar, 4 Tbsp of fine gochugaru, 2 Tbsp of gukganjang, 1.5 Tbsp of sweet maesil extract, and 2 Tbsp of minced garlic for aromatic depth. Mix these ingredients thoroughly with a spoon or whisk until smooth and well combined, ensuring there are no lumps. This sauce will meld beautifully with the other ingredients to create a rich flavor.

Step 2

Now, let’s get the vegetables ready. Wash the 1/2 carrot and slice it diagonally into about 0.5 cm thick pieces. This cut not only looks appealing but also helps the carrot absorb the flavors better and adds a pleasant texture. In a wide pan, add the prepared beef bulgogi and the sliced carrots. Stir-fry over medium-high heat just until the meat’s pinkness begins to fade. This quick sautéing step is crucial for eliminating any gamey odors from the beef and ensuring a clean, clear broth later on. Be careful not to overcook or burn it; sauté for just 1-2 minutes.

Step 3

Once the beef bulgogi and carrots have been sautéed for a moment, add the mushrooms and 2 Korean green chilies. Prepare your mushrooms by slicing them into bite-sized pieces according to their type. Finely chop the green chilies to add a spicy kick. If you prefer less heat, you can omit the green chilies or remove their seeds beforehand. Sauté for another minute to release their aromas.

Step 4

Now it’s time to create the flavorful broth. Pour about 1.5 cups (approximately 300ml) of water into the pan. The amount of water should be enough to generously cover the bulgogi and vegetables. Once the water comes to a boil, spoon the prepared seasoning sauce evenly over the ingredients in the pan. Gently stir with a spoon to help the sauce dissolve and then bring it to a rolling boil over high heat. Cooking at high heat allows the sauce to penetrate the ingredients quickly and develop a deeper flavor.

Step 5

As the stew begins to bubble vigorously, add the green onion for a final touch of fresh flavor and aroma. Cutting the green onion into larger pieces not only enhances the visual appeal but also adds a refreshing sweetness to the broth. After adding the green onion, continue to simmer for another 2-3 minutes, allowing its subtle sweetness and fragrance to infuse into the liquid.

Step 6

And there you have it – your delicious Spicy Stir-Fried Bulgogi is ready! You can enjoy it in two delightful ways, depending on your preference. If you enjoy a soupier dish, you can serve it as ‘Beef Bulgogi Hot Pot’ and eat it with rice or like a stew. Alternatively, if you prefer a thicker, more concentrated flavor, continue to simmer it until the sauce reduces and thickens for a classic ‘Spicy Stir-Fried Bulgogi’ (Duruchigi) experience.
